
At the meeting, part of the PM’s workingvisit to the Mekong Delta region, Secretary of the provincial PartyCommittee Ngo Chi Cuong reported that the local socio-economic situation has continuedrecovering and developing in 2023.
During the first nine months, thegross regional domestic product (GRDP) increased 8.51%, ranking second among the 13Mekong Delta localities and 11th among the 63 nationwide. The industrialproduction value reached 26.63 trillion VND (over 1 billion USD), up 12.48%;agro-forestry-fishery production nearly 21.8 billion VND, up 2.04%; and total goodsretail sales and service revenue almost 41.9 trillion VND, up 21.23%.
Eight of the nine district-levellocalities in Tra Vinh have completed new-style countryside building while allof its 85 communes have been recognised as new-style rural areas. Investment hasalso been stepped up, with total investment in society approximating 22.1trillion VND, up 14.15%, and disbursed capital reaching 52.54%.
Cuongalso highlighted improvements in cultural and social aspects, health care,social security, poverty reduction, along with guaranteed political securityand social order and safety, and the maintained focus on the Party andpolitical system building.
ApplaudingTra Vinh’s efforts and achievements, PM Chinh underlined local advantages,including a strategic location in terms of economy, defence and security, a65km coastline that makes it a key province in the marine economy development,fertile soil, biological diversity, favourable conditions for renewable energydevelopment, tourism advantages, and a young and abundant workforce.
Healso pointed out certain difficulties and challenges needing to be addressedsuch as untapped economic potential, a small-scale economy, poor transportinfrastructure, and impacts from climate change.
